The MAX5402 µPoT digital potentiometer is a 256-tap variable resistor with 10kΩ total resistance in a tiny 8-pin µMAX® package. This device functions as a mechanical potentiometer, consisting of a fixed resistor string with a digitally controlled wiper contact. It operates from +2.7V to +5.5V single-supply voltages and uses an ultra-low 0.1µA supply current. This device also provides glitchless switching between resistor taps, as well as a convenient power-on reset (POR) that sets the wiper to the midscale position at power-up. A low 5ppm/°C ratiometric temperature coefficient makes it ideal for applications requiring low drift.
The MAX5402 serves well in applications requiring digitally controlled resistors, including adjustable voltage references and programmable gain amplifiers (PGAs). A nominal end-to-end resistor temperature coefficient of 35ppm/°C makes this part suitable for use as a variable resistor in applications such as low-tempco adjustable gain and other circuit configurations. This device is guaranteed over the extended industrial temperature range (-40°C to +85°C).
Key Features
Applications/Uses
Small Footprint, 8-Pin µMAX Package
Ultra-Low 100nA Supply Current
+2.7V to +5.5V Single-Supply Operation
256 Tap Positions
Low Ratiometric Temperature Coefficient 5ppm/°C
Low End-to-End Resistor Temperature Coefficient 35ppm/°C
Power-On Reset: Wiper Goes to Midscale (Position 128)
